鸿蒙DNS的核心架构与设计理念
鸿蒙DNS(HarmonyOS DNS)是鸿蒙操作系统(HarmonyOS)中负责域名解析的关键组件,其设计旨在为分布式设备提供高效、安全、智能的网络服务支持,与传统DNS系统不同,鸿蒙DNS深度融合了鸿蒙的分布式特性,通过轻量化协议和本地化缓存机制,优化了跨设备、跨场景的域名解析效率,它不仅支持标准DNS查询,还结合了鸿蒙的分布式软总线技术,实现了设备间的协同解析,降低了中心服务器的负载压力。
技术特点:分布式与智能化的结合
鸿蒙DNS的核心优势在于其分布式架构,传统DNS依赖集中式服务器,而鸿蒙DNS通过设备间的节点互助,构建了去中心化的解析网络,当一台设备完成域名解析后,会将结果缓存至本地网络中的其他设备,形成“解析共享池”,后续请求可直接从邻近节点获取响应,大幅减少延迟,鸿蒙DNS引入了AI预测算法,根据用户的使用习惯和设备位置,预加载高频访问域名的解析结果,进一步提升了响应速度。
安全机制:抵御网络威胁的第一道防线
在安全性方面,鸿蒙DNS采用了多层次防护策略,它支持DNS over HTTPS(DoH)和DNS over TLS(DoT)协议,确保解析过程中的数据加密,防止中间人攻击,鸿蒙DNS内置了恶意域名黑名单库,可实时拦截钓鱼网站、僵尸网络等恶意地址的解析请求,结合鸿蒙系统的微内核设计,DNS服务运行在独立的安全沙箱中,即使遭遇攻击也能快速隔离,避免影响系统其他部分。
应用场景:赋能全场景智慧生活
鸿蒙DNS的应用场景覆盖了从个人设备到工业互联网的广泛领域,在智能家居中,它确保不同品牌设备间的快速发现与连接;在车联网中,低延迟的域名解析保障了实时导航和车辆控制的安全性;对于企业级应用,鸿蒙DNS的分布式特性可支持大规模物联网设备的并发请求,避免了传统DNS的单点故障风险,鸿蒙开发者还可通过开放的API接口,自定义DNS解析策略,以满足特定业务需求。
未来发展:向更智能的网络服务演进
随着鸿蒙系统的持续迭代,鸿蒙DNS也在不断进化,它将进一步融合边缘计算能力,将解析节点下沉到更靠近用户的网络边缘,实现“近场解析”,通过引入区块链技术,鸿蒙DNS有望构建去信任化的域名解析体系,确保解析记录的不可篡改性,鸿蒙团队还在探索与6G网络的结合,为未来超低延迟、超高并发的网络环境提供支撑。
相关问答FAQs
Q1:鸿蒙DNS与传统DNS的主要区别是什么?
A1:鸿蒙DNS采用分布式架构,支持设备间协同解析和本地缓存,而传统DNS依赖集中式服务器;鸿蒙DNS集成了AI预测、加密传输和恶意拦截等安全与智能功能,更适合跨设备、多场景的复杂网络环境。
Q2:鸿蒙DNS如何保障用户隐私安全?
A2:鸿蒙DNS通过DoH/DoT协议加密解析数据,防止信息泄露;本地缓存机制减少了对远程服务器的依赖,降低了数据被窃取的风险,其沙箱运行设计也确保了DNS服务的安全性,避免成为攻击入口。
来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/310976.html